Across TCGA patient cohorts, LINC01657 RNA expression is significantly associated with the go_rna of many other GO terms, with 5,596 significant associations in total. STAD shows the largest number of these associations.

The most reproducible LINC01657-associated GO terms across cancer lineages are Regulation of protein ubiquitination, Positive regulation of protein modification by small protein conjugation or removal, and Regulation of RNA splicing. Each is linked with LINC01657 in more than 10 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both LINC01657-to-partner and partner-to-LINC01657 results are reported.
